The word 'status' is an abstract noun, a word for a concept.The word 'prospect' is an abstract noun as a word for the possibility that something will occur in the future, a word for a concept.The word 'prospect' is a concrete noun as a word for someone or something that is likely to succeed or to be chosen; a word for a person or a thing.

The word 'worry' is both a verb and a noun.The noun 'worry' is an abstract noun, a word for a problem or possibility that makes you feel uneasy, a word for an emotion.example: My big worry is that the cost may soon rise.

The noun 'scope' is an abstract noun as a word for the extent of the area or subject matter that something deals with; an opportunity or possibility to do or deal with something; a word for a concept.,The noun 'scope' is a concrete noun as a word for an optical viewing device; an physical area in which something acts or operates or has power or control.
